Are you interested in providing critical intervention to children and adolescents with severe emotional and behavioral health needs? If so, Devereux has a great opportunity for you! We are seeking to hire a compassionate individual to join our team as an Behavior Analyst.

Devereux - Florida provides programs and services for children and adolescents with emotional, behavioral and mental health or intellectual / developmental disabilities. Based in Viera, FL, this position is responsible for the development and implementation of the clients master treatment plan, works within a multidisciplinary team to review the clients treatment and goals, and assesses progress and future needs. Behavior Analyst are over the assessment and discharge planning process to establish goals for the reduction in challenging behavior, instruction in functionally equivalent responses, and functional communication.

Company Overview

Devereux is one of the nation’s largest nonprofit organizations, providing services, insight and leadership in the evolving field of behavioral healthcare. Founded in 1912, Devereux operates a comprehensive national network of clinical, therapeutic, educational and employment programs that positively impact the lives of 10,000+ children, adults – and their families – every year.

Our Mission

Devereux changes lives – by unlocking and nurturing human potential for people living with emotional, behavioral or cognitive differences.
